The Critical Link Between Gum Health and Implant Success
Gum disease is an infection that destroys the bone and tissues supporting your teeth. Because dental implants also rely on this same bone for support, placing an implant into an unhealthy environment is destined for failure. This is why successfully treating gum disease is the essential first step on your journey to a new smile.
The Non-Negotiable Requirements for Implants After Gum Disease
For a dental implant to be successful and last a lifetime, we must first ensure two conditions are met:
The Gum Disease Must Be Under Control: We cannot place an implant in a mouth with active periodontal disease. Our first priority is always to eliminate the infection and stabilize your gums through targeted periodontal therapy, such as deep cleanings or laser treatment.
There Must Be Sufficient Bone Support: Periodontitis often causes significant bone loss. A dental implant needs a strong, dense base of bone to integrate with. If you have experienced bone loss, we can rebuild this foundation using advanced bone grafting techniques.
Only when your mouth is healthy and stable can we proceed with a successful and predictable implant treatment.

A Coordinated Plan for Your Success
Comprehensive Evaluation & 3D Scan: Your journey begins with a detailed exam and a state-of-the-art 3D CBCT scan. This allows us to precisely assess the extent of your gum disease and bone loss.
Targeted Periodontal Therapy: We will perform the necessary treatments to eliminate the active infection and restore your gums to health.
Rebuilding Your Foundation (If Needed): If you have experienced bone loss, we will perform a bone graft or sinus lift to regenerate the bone, creating a solid base for your future implant.
Precision Implant Placement: Once your foundation is healthy and strong, we will use computer-guided technology to place your dental implant with sub-millimeter accuracy.
Your Final, Beautiful Restoration: After a healing period, we will attach your custom-made dental crown, bridge, or denture to the implant, completing your beautiful, functional, and permanent new smile.
